Bitcoin Hacking Wallet: Understanding the Risks
A Bitcoin wallet is a digital storage device used to store, send, and receive Bitcoin. It can be in the form of a software application, hardware device, or a paper-based wallet. However, these wallets are not immune to hacking attempts, which can lead to the loss of your Bitcoin.
1. Phishing Attacks: Phishing is a common method used by hackers to steal Bitcoin wallet credentials. They send fraudulent emails or messages, tricking users into providing their private keys or login information.
2. Malware: Hackers can infect your computer or mobile device with malware, which can steal your Bitcoin wallet's private keys and drain your wallet of funds.
3. Social Engineering: This involves manipulating individuals into revealing their private keys or login information. Hackers may pose as a trusted entity, such as a Bitcoin exchange or wallet provider, to gain access to your wallet.
4. Brute Force Attacks: Hackers use this method to guess your private key by trying every possible combination until they find the correct one.
5. Exploiting Vulnerabilities: Some Bitcoin wallets may have vulnerabilities that hackers can exploit to gain unauthorized access to your wallet.
Bitcoin Hacking Wallet: Preventive Measures
To protect your Bitcoin wallet from hacking attempts, it is essential to implement the following preventive measures:
1. Use a Secure Wallet: Opt for a reputable and secure Bitcoin wallet that employs advanced encryption and security features. Hardware wallets, such as Ledger and Trezor, are considered the most secure option.
2. Keep Your Private Keys Private: Never share your private keys with anyone, as they are the key to accessing your Bitcoin wallet. Store your private keys in a secure location, such as a password-protected computer or a physical storage device.
3.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Two-factor authentication adds an extra layer of security to your Bitcoin wallet by requiring a second form of verification, such as a unique code sent to your mobile device.
4. Keep Your Software Updated: Regularly update your Bitcoin wallet software to ensure that you have the latest security patches and fixes.
5. Be Wary of Phishing Attempts: Always verify the legitimacy of emails, messages, and websites before providing any sensitive information.
6. Use Strong Passwords: Create strong, unique passwords for your Bitcoin wallet and other online accounts. Avoid using easily guessable passwords or reusing them across multiple platforms.
7. Backup Your Wallet: Regularly backup your Bitcoin wallet to prevent data loss. Store the backup in a secure location, separate from your primary device.
